Is Center Bluff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is safe. Center Bluff in Peoria, IL has a safety grade of A-. The overall crime index is 100, which is 0% below the national average of 100. Center Bluff is safer than 50% of neighborhoods in Peoria.

Compared to the Peoria average (crime index 105), Center Bluff is 5% lower in overall crime. Crime levels here are roughly in line with the city average.

Looking at specific crime types, murder is the most elevated concern (index: 97, 3% below average), while rape is the lowest risk (index: 41).
